How Much Does a Grants And Contracts Specialist Make in Oklahoma?

Updated May 28, 2024
Filter

Individually reported data submitted by users of our website

Low Confidence
$113,961/yr
Average Base Pay
Low $96,408
Average $113,961
High $130,024
The average salary for Grants And Contracts Specialist is $113,961 per year in Oklahoma.

CITY ANNUAL SALARY MONTHLY PAY WEEKLY PAY HOURLY WAGE
Tulsa $116,548 $9,712 $2,241 $56
Broken Arrow $116,179 $9,682 $2,234 $56
Bartlesville $115,439 $9,620 $2,220 $55
Muskogee $115,439 $9,620 $2,220 $55
Oklahoma City $112,483 $9,374 $2,163 $54
Edmond $112,113 $9,343 $2,156 $54
Norman $111,743 $9,312 $2,149 $54
Enid $111,374 $9,281 $2,142 $54
Stillwater $111,374 $9,281 $2,142 $54
Lawton $104,844 $8,737 $2,016 $50

What is the average of a Grants And Contracts Specialist in Oklahoma?

The Grants And Contracts Specialist salary range is from $96,408 to $130,024, and the average Grants And Contracts Specialist salary is $113,961/year in Oklahoma. The Grants And Contracts Specialist's salary will change in different locations.

Which location pays the highest Grants And Contracts Specialist salary in the United States?

The Grants And Contracts Specialist salary in San Jose, CA is $154,617 which is the highest in the US.

What kinds of reasons will influence the Grants And Contracts Specialist's salary?

Besides the location, employees' education degree, related skills, and work experience also will influence the salary. Try to improve your skills and experience to get a higher salary for the position of Grants And Contracts Specialist.
